如何找matlab数据库
-
要在Matlab中连接数据库,可以使用内置的Database Toolbox。以下是几种常见的方法:
-
通过连接URL链接数据库:
可以使用database函数通过URL连接到数据库,例如:conn = database('myDB','username','password','Vendor','MySQL','Server','myServer','PortNumber',3306);其中
myDB是数据库名称,username和password是数据库登录凭据,MySQL是数据库类型,myServer是数据库服务器,3306是端口号。 -
通过ODBC链接数据库:
也可以使用ODBC数据源名称(DSN)连接数据库。首先需要在Windows的ODBC数据源管理器中创建一个数据源。然后可以使用以下代码连接到数据库:conn = database('DSNname','username','password'); -
通过JDBC链接数据库:
如果数据库支持JDBC驱动程序,也可以使用JDBC连接到数据库。例如:conn = database('databasename','username','password','com.mysql.jdbc.Driver','jdbc:mysql://hostname:port/databasename'); -
查询数据库:
连接到数据库后,可以使用exec函数执行SQL查询语句。例如:results = exec(conn, 'SELECT * FROM myTable'); fetchedData = fetch(results); -
关闭数据库连接:
最后,要记得在使用完数据库后关闭连接,以释放资源:close(conn);
无论连接哪种类型的数据库,都要确保在连接之前已经安装了适当的驱动程序或工具箱。Matlab的文档中也提供了广泛的连接数据库的指南和示例,可供参考。
1年前 -
-
在MATLAB中查找数据库通常指的是在MATLAB中访问和管理与数据库相关的数据。常见的数据库包括MySQL、Oracle、Microsoft SQL Server等。想在MATLAB中访问数据库,可以通过MATLAB自带的Database Toolbox或者ODBC接口来连接数据库。接下来我将详细介绍如何在MATLAB中通过Database Toolbox或ODBC接口来连接数据库。
首先,使用MATLAB自带的Database Toolbox连接数据库。Database Toolbox是MATLAB中用于连接数据库的工具箱,支持连接多种类型的数据库,包括MySQL、Oracle、Microsoft SQL Server等。下面是使用Database Toolbox连接数据库的基本步骤:
- 连接数据库:首先使用
database函数创建一个数据库连接对象。例如,如果要连接到名为"mydb"的MySQL数据库,可以使用以下命令:
conn = database('mydb', 'username', 'password', 'com.mysql.jdbc.Driver', 'jdbc:mysql://hostname:port/database_name')这里需要替换
username、password、hostname、port、database_name等参数为实际的数据库登录信息。- 执行查询:连接成功之后,就可以使用
exec函数执行SQL查询了。例如,可以执行一个简单的查询,并将结果存储在MATLAB变量中:
results = exec(conn, 'SELECT * FROM mytable'); results = fetch(results);3.处理数据:获取数据之后,可以在MATLAB中对数据进行进一步处理和分析。
4.关闭连接:在完成数据库操作之后,要记得使用
close函数关闭数据库连接:close(conn);接下来,我们来看看如何使用ODBC接口在MATLAB中连接数据库。ODBC (Open Database Connectivity) 是一种用于连接数据库的标准接口,几乎所有的主流数据库系统都可以通过ODBC接口进行访问。在MATLAB中,可以使用
database函数结合ODBC数据源名称来连接数据库。以下是具体步骤:-
注册ODBC数据源:首先需要在计算机上注册相应的ODBC数据源。具体操作取决于数据库的类型,比如对于MySQL数据库,需要在控制面板的ODBC数据源中添加一个数据源。
-
连接数据库:接下来,在MATLAB中使用
database函数连接数据库。假设已经在计算机上注册了名为“my_mysql_db”的MySQL数据源,可以使用以下命令连接数据库:
conn = database('my_mysql_db', 'username', 'password');和使用Database Toolbox连接数据库一样,这里需要替换
username、password为实际的数据库登录信息。- 执行查询和处理数据等步骤与使用Database Toolbox连接数据库的步骤类似。
总的来说,在MATLAB中连接数据库通常可以通过使用MATLAB自带的Database Toolbox或者ODBC接口来实现。通过以上步骤,您可以在MATLAB中轻松地连接数据库,并进行数据的读取和处理。
1年前 - 连接数据库:首先使用
-
在 MATLAB 中使用数据库,可以借助 MATLAB Database Toolbox。这个工具箱提供了各种功能和工具,可以用来连接、查询和处理数据库。
步骤一:安装 MATLAB Database Toolbox
首先,确保你的 MATLAB 已经安装了 Database Toolbox。如果尚未安装,你可以按照以下步骤进行安装:
- 打开 MATLAB 软件。
- 在顶部菜单栏找到 "Add-Ons",然后选择 "Get Add-Ons"。
- 在 "Get Add-Ons" 界面搜索框中输入 "Database Toolbox"。
- 选择 "Database Toolbox" 并进行安装。
步骤二:连接数据库
一旦安装了 Database Toolbox,你可以使用它来连接到你的数据库。以下是连接到数据库的一般步骤:
-
加载数据库驱动程序:使用
database函数加载数据库驱动程序。在 MATLAB 命令窗口输入以下代码,替换相应的数据库连接参数。conn = database('DatabaseName','username','password','VendorDriver','JDBCDriverLocation');DatabaseName:数据库的名称或者 DSN。username:数据库的用户名。password:数据库的密码。VendorDriver:数据库的 JDBCDriverLocation。
-
测试连接:一旦创建了连接,你可以使用
isopen函数测试连接是否成功。if isopen(conn) disp('数据库连接成功。'); else disp('数据库连接失败。'); end
步骤三:查询数据库
成功连接到数据库后,你可以执行 SQL 查询来检索数据。例如,你可以使用
fetch函数来执行 SQL 查询并获取结果数据。data = fetch(conn,'SELECT * FROM TableName');在上面的代码中,
SELECT * FROM TableName是你要执行的 SQL 查询语句。你可以根据需要修改查询语句。步骤四:处理数据
一旦获取了数据库中的数据,你可以在 MATLAB 中对其进行处理和分析。这包括数据的可视化、统计分析等操作。
步骤五:关闭连接
当你完成了数据库操作后,记得关闭数据库连接,释放资源。
close(conn);以上是使用 MATLAB Database Toolbox 连接和操作数据库的一般步骤。具体的操作需要根据你所使用的数据库类型和数据处理需求来进行调整。
1年前


